Linux 从shell脚本执行时使用psql关闭postgres连接

Linux 从shell脚本执行时使用psql关闭postgres连接,linux,postgresql,shell,psql,Linux,Postgresql,Shell,Psql,如何在从shell脚本执行时使用psql关闭连接 psql-c'/*SQL语句*/' 或 psql-f script.sql 命令一执行,连接就会自动关闭Laurenz Albe,谢谢你的回答,我已经通过jenkins安排了工作,每1小时我的postgres DB就会出现一次,在此期间我会收到这个错误“无法从DB:pq获取SSH指纹:剩余的连接插槽保留给非复制超级用户连接“我怀疑这可能是因为脚本没有关闭连接。根据你的回答,它应该关闭连接,你知道我为什么会出现这个错误吗?还有很多其他的数据库连

如何在从shell脚本执行时使用psql关闭连接

psql-c'/*SQL语句*/'

psql-f script.sql

命令一执行,连接就会自动关闭

Laurenz Albe,谢谢你的回答,我已经通过jenkins安排了工作,每1小时我的postgres DB就会出现一次,在此期间我会收到这个错误“无法从DB:pq获取SSH指纹:剩余的连接插槽保留给非复制超级用户连接“我怀疑这可能是因为脚本没有关闭连接。根据你的回答,它应该关闭连接,你知道我为什么会出现这个错误吗?还有很多其他的数据库连接。检查
pg_stat_activity
,找出它们的来源。